Job Summary
• Our client is currently seeking to recruit Project Field Officers. The successful officer is expected to manage implementation of the project activities, document project successes, prepare activity-based reports and communicate on the project progress.

Key responsibilities
Under the supervision of Project M&E Officer and overall guidance and Technical support from Programs Manager, you will be responsible for:
1. Reporting to Project Monitoring & Evaluation Officer on activities done.
2. Face of the organization and project at Field/Community level. Link between the community gate keepers, opinion leaders and local leadership and the project organization.
3. Work with Evidence Based Intervention (EBI) Facilitators to plan, mobilize and implement project activities.
4. Supervise EBI facilitators and other community resource persons engaged in the project, to deliver.
5. Oversee implementation of Project Activities. And taking accountability for all activities done.
6. Planning and Mobilization of participants to project activities.
7. Consultation with the Project M&E Officer on implementation of the field activities.
8. Support in the development a monthly work plan and weekly work schedules of field activities.
9. Prepare narrative reports of all field activities implemented and report on time.
10. Support Project M&E Officer on achieving activity implementation cut-off dates and reporting deadlines to the organization and project donor.
11. Monthly documentation of success, impact stories and best practices as a result of project activities.
12. Prepare and submit activity payment invoices and sheets to Project M&E Officer for review and payment.
13. Provide on job/ capacity building to EBIs Facilitators on data recording and reporting through reporting forums and meetings.
14. Support Data Management processes: collection, tallying, verification, entry, cleaning, confidentiality, quality checks and analysis.
15. Together with Project M&E Officer, conduct weekly reporting, progress review and planning meetings with EBI facilitators and other resource persons engaged.
16. Participate in Monitoring and Evaluation visits to project implementation sites.
17. Support project M&E Officer on generation of project reports, talking points and presentations.
18. Represent or Participate in partner/ stakeholder meetings at Ward, Village and Sub County level.
19. Undertake any other project related task or activity deemed necessary to ensure project success.

Qualification Requirements
 A minimum of 2 years experience relevant to working as a Project M&E or Field Officer.
 A bachelor Degree or Diploma holder in either Monitoring and Evaluation, Project Planning & Management, Community Health and other relevant Social Science courses.
 An understanding and experience of Human Rights and Gender issues will be an added advantage.
 An experience of working in the rural set ups with an NGO or Government project, with an understanding of community dynamics.
 An experience of working and interacting with Youths and children below 18 years of age.
 Have proficiency in Computer application skills. Excel, Word and Power Point competency is a MUST.
 Personal attributes (self-driven, excellent communication, presentation and reporting skills, analytical skills and team player).
